Ingredients:
- I purchased a whole wheat organic pizza crust from Trader Joe’s (90 calories per serving)
- 2 Chicken Breasts
- 1 cup Frank’s Hot Sauce
- 2 Cups Spinach, Chopped
- 1 medium red onion
- 1/2 cup tomato sauce
- 1 tsp cayenne pepper
- 1 tsp chili powder
- 1 tsp garlic powder
- 1/4 cup mozz. cheese
Directions:
1. Season Chicken with cayenne, garlic powder, & chili powder and bake on 400 for 20 minutes.
2. On pizza crust- put tomato sauce, top with spinach & onion.
3. Cut chicken into small pieces and toss in hot sauce. Place on pizza
4. Top with Mozz Cheese
5. Bake on 425 for 8 minutes.
6. Cut pizza into 6 slices. 2 slices is ONE portion.
